Title :
A radio-frequency tunable active filter

Abstract :
A design approach for a tunable active filter of constant bandwidth and center-frequency gain is described. The approach is based on a feedback configuration with a complex zero pair in the feedback transfer function. Center frequency tuning is achieved with the variation of only one element, a potentiometer, which controls the feedback loop gain. A circuit realization using two commercial video amplifiers with RC embedding is presented. A tuning range of 25 percent at 5 MHz, with a nominal bandwidth of 90 kHz or 180 kHz, and a variation of center-frequency gain of less than /spl plusmn/1 dB over the tuning range, is obtained.
